19.3.9 Quitting BOOT
F Quit system monitoring
(1) Quit system monitoring.
1 Using the [UP] or [DOWN] soft key, position the cursor to 10. END
on the SYSTEM MONITOR MAIN MENU.
2 Press the [SELECT] soft key.

(2) To quit system monitoring, press the [YES] soft key.
To continue system monitoring, press the [NO] soft key.
³ The NC system starts in the same way as when the power
is first turned on. The following messages are displayed on the
screen:
“CHECK CNC BASIC SYSTEM”

NOTE If the correct NC basic software (NC basic file) is not written into the
FROM, the system monitor screen is displayed again.
